Directorate General of Training, Ministry of Skill Development and Training (MSDE) is going to organize the programme for the 100th Regional Skill Competition for apprentices. The competition will be held in the month of September 2018.
The competition intends to be held in 15 trades i.e. Turner, Fitter, Machinist, Electrician, Welder (G&E), Mechanic (Motor Vehicle), Electronic Mechanic, Draughtsman (Mechanical), Instrument Mechanic, Mechanic Machine Tool Maintenance, Tool & Die Maker (Dies and Moulds), Tool and Die Maker (Press tools, jigs and fixtures),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Mechanic, Mechanic (Diesel) and Wireman to be conducted in the Month of September 2018 as per the programme given in the attachment below.
The venue for the competition would be at NSTI’s – Howrah, Mumbai, Chennai, Hyderabad, Kanpur and Ludhiana

The state apprenticeship advisers and Regional Directors of Apprenticeship Training Scheme are requested to furnish the full particulars of eligible apprentices in the above mentioned 15 trades to the Directors of NSTIs where trainees are supposed to appear for the 100th Regional Skill Competition.

Important to Note:
- The result for the competition of the trades: Instrument Mechanic, Electronic Mechanic, Mechanic Machine Tool Maintenance, Tool & Die Maker (Dies and Moulds), Tool and Die Maker (Press tools, jigs and fixtures),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Mechanic, Mechanic (Diesel), Draughtsman (Mechanical) will be compiled separately for each region and should be sent to the Directors of NSTIs concerned to which region the competition belongs so as to enable them to declare the result along with the candidate of the remaining trades.
- Any competitor directed wrongly to other Centre either by the State Apprenticeship Advisor or Regional Director will not be allowed to take the competition and in case he/she is permitted the sole responsibility shall rest with the Director of NSTIs
